These treats are full of good and healthy ingredients . .
Applesauce, oatmeal, whole wheat flour, and pumpkin!
Dog Gone Good Pumpkin Dog Treats
Makes approximately 5 – 6 dozen treats depending on size of your cookie cutters.

Ingredients
1/2 cup unsweetened applesauce
1 egg
1 /2 cup pure pumpkin
1 teaspoon vanilla
1/2 teaspoon cinnamon
1 1/4 cups water
4 cups whole-wheat flour
1/2 cup cornmeal
3/4 cup quick cook oats, *set aside 1/4 cup
Directions
Preheat oven to 350 degrees.
In a large mixing bowl, combine applesauce, egg, pumpkin, vanilla & water.
In a second bowl, combine flour, cornmeal, cinnamon and *1/2 cup oats.
Add dry to wet ingredients and mix well. (I used the food processor to pulse everything together for easy mixing.)
Turn dough onto floured surface and knead.
*Sprinkle reserved ¼ cup oats on top of dough and roll out to ¼ inch thick and cut into shapes.
Add additional flour as needed if dough is too sticky.
Reroll scraps and repeat.
Place on parchment or greased cookie sheet and bake 25 – 35 minutes, depending on the size and your oven. Watch and remove when slightly browned. Cool on a rack and store in sealed container.
*You can mix the entire ¾ cup of oats in all at once with the other dry ingredients if you prefer.
Score lines for veins in the leaves and turkeys and sprinkle oatmeal on tops if desired before baking.
